Answer 1:
There are various risk factors or precursors to adolescent pregnancy that medical college students should be aware of. These factors may include poverty, lack of education, limited access to contraception, peer pressure, and sexual abuse, among others. It is important for medical college students to understand that these risk factors can have a compounding effect, increasing the likelihood of adolescent pregnancy.

Community and state resources devoted to adolescent pregnancy can help prevent and address this issue. Two such resources that medical college students can research and discuss include Teen Pregnancy Prevention Programs and Adolescent Health Centers. Teen Pregnancy Prevention Programs work to provide education, counseling, and outreach to adolescents, while Adolescent Health Centers provide a range of health services, including reproductive health and family planning.

According to data from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), teen pregnancy rates have declined in recent years. However, it is important to note that rates vary by state and community. Medical college students should research the teen pregnancy rates for their state and community and discuss possible reasons for an increase or decrease.

Possible reasons for a decrease in teen pregnancy rates may include increased access to education and contraception, improved healthcare services, and greater awareness of the risks associated with adolescent pregnancy. Conversely, an increase in rates may be attributed to a lack of access to contraception or healthcare services, inadequate education, and/or an increase in risk-taking behaviors.

Answer 2:
Adolescence is a challenging time that presents unique stressors that can have significant impacts on an individual’s mental and physical health. Two external stressors that are unique to adolescents include social media and academic pressure. Social media can perpetuate feelings of isolation, anxiety, and depression, while academic pressure can cause stress, burnout, and poor mental health.

These stressors can lead to risk-taking behaviors such as substance abuse, self-harm, and risky sexual behavior. It is important for medical college students to identify support and coping mechanisms that can help address these behaviors. Examples of coping mechanisms may include healthy forms of self-expression, such as art or music, support from peers or family members, and the development of healthy habits such as regular exercise and proper nutrition.

As medical professionals, it is crucial for medical college students to also recognize the mental health impacts of external stressors and provide support when necessary. Referral to licensed therapists or mental health professionals may be necessary for individuals experiencing severe mental distress. Additionally, advocacy for improved policies and resources for adolescent mental health may help address these issues at a larger scale.
